Responsibilities
- Serve as the primary point of contact at the front desk, greeting visitors and managing incoming calls with professionalism and courtesy
- Operate multi-line phone systems, direct calls appropriately, and handle inquiries efficiently
- Manage calendar scheduling, appointments, and meeting arrangements for staff and executives
- Maintain accurate records through data entry, filing, and document proofreading to ensure organizational integrity
- Oversee office supplies inventory, place orders as needed, and coordinate maintenance or repairs to keep the workspace functional
- Support bookkeeping tasks using QuickBooks or similar accounting software to assist with invoicing and expense tracking
- Provide exceptional customer service by assisting clients, vendors, and team members promptly and courteously
Skills
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ook) and Google Workspace for document creation, email communication, and collaboration
- Strong organizational skills with the ability to multitask effectively in a fast-paced environment
- Excellent phone etiquette with experience managing multi-line phone systems and providing customer support
- Bilingual abilities are highly desirable to serve diverse client needs effectively
- Office management experience combined with clerical expertise including filing, data entry, proofreading, and calendar management
- Knowledge of medical or dental receptionist procedures is a plus for healthcare-related offices
- Personal assistant experience or medical receptionist background is beneficial for understanding complex scheduling and client interactions
